Output b937873a3ba7c33a3e494c83bbed500ca08ca950dc20bf5e4fc551fa80c763d3:18

value
145052613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2a7094c6dc9cb01d874fd79444390e55e22984 OP_EQUAL
address
3JqwoNh5K6wrncN21Q4MwfABGh7t66ebeD
transaction
b937873a3ba7c33a3e494c83bbed500ca08ca950dc20bf5e4fc551fa80c763d3
spent
true